If the company were to liquidate by selling off all its assets and paying off all its debts, whatever is left over would be the stockholders' equity -- the amount the company could distribute to its shareholders. On a company's balance sheet, "stockholders' equity," also called "shareholders' equity," is a measure of that business' true value. An easy way to remember this is to put it into the form of the accounting equation: A (assets) = L (liabilities) + E (shareholders' equity). Statement of Changes in Equity, often referred to as Statement of Retained Earnings in U.S. GAAP, details the change in owners' equity over an accounting period by presenting the movement in reserves comprising the shareholders' equity.
